Window Wells Repair in Denver, CO

Window well repair services address issues related to the structural integrity and safety of window wells around basement windows. These repairs typically involve fixing or replacing damaged or rusted metal or plastic wells, sealing leaks, and ensuring proper drainage to prevent water intrusion. Projects may include restoring old, corroded wells, installing new wells for basement windows, or upgrading existing structures to improve durability and appearance. Homeowners often seek these services to protect their basements from water damage, improve exterior curb appeal, and ensure that window wells remain secure and functional during harsh weather conditions.

Before requesting window well repair, property owners usually want to understand the extent of damage or deterioration, the materials involved, and the potential impact on their property’s foundation and basement. It’s common to inquire about the best options for replacing or reinforcing existing wells, as well as any necessary drainage improvements to prevent future water issues. Common Window Wells Repair Jobs

Window Well Repair - restores damaged or deteriorated window wells to prevent water intrusion.

Leak Prevention - seals leaks around window wells to protect basements from water damage.

Rust and Corrosion Repair - addresses rusted or corroded metal wells to extend their lifespan.

Structural Reinforcement - stabilizes unstable or sagging window wells for added safety.

Drainage Solutions - upgrades drainage systems to prevent water accumulation around window wells.

Cover Replacement - installs or replaces window well covers to keep debris out and improve safety.

Window Wells Repair Questions

What are common issues with window wells? Common problems include rust, cracking, and water leakage into basements.

How can I tell if my window well needs repair? Signs include water pooling around the well, rust spots, or difficulty opening the window.

What types of repairs are typically performed? Repairs may involve patching rusted areas, sealing leaks, or replacing damaged covers and walls.

Why is repairing a window well important? Proper repairs prevent water intrusion, structural damage, and improve safety around basement windows.
